Subject: DR drill — InvoiceForge renderer, Thursday

Welcome aboard. Thursday's drill simulates total loss of the InvoiceForge PDF rendering cluster in the Dunmere region. Your role: restore the renderer from the cold snapshot, verify font embedding, and confirm a test invoice renders identically to the golden copy. You'll need access to the sealed restore account, which stays dormant outside drills. Do not reset it; doing so invalidates the escrow. The account's recovery passphrase is recorded below.

vault phrase of kajop-kaweg = sorix-istys-noviel

Release checklist — GrowMind controller v4 gate: verify humidity sensor drift compensation. The Fernhollow test bench showed 3% drift over 48h on the older probe batch; the new calibration curve must be confirmed active before shipping. Run the 12h soak, confirm drift stays under 0.8%, and record results in the hardware log. Do not skip the cold-start case; that's where drift was worst. The soak run to cite is tagged with the token below.

pipeline stamp: htk31_f769b577b3028a4e9958e5bb8d1259a

The proposed plan adds 34 roles across Veldane Systems, weighted toward the Corsa platform engineering group and the Tillbrook support center. Attrition modeling assumes 9% voluntary turnover, consistent with the past two years. Contractor conversion accounts for 11 of the new positions, reducing agency spend meaningfully. Regional salary benchmarks have been refreshed for the Ostlin market. One assumption underpinning the second-half hiring wave is tied to a sensitive matter noted below.

internal memo for tafog-kageg: Headcount on the Tamion team goes from 9 to 94 by the end of May. Gross margin on Tamion came in at 23 percent against a plan of 58 percent.

## Digest Scheduling — Onboarding Notes

Batch email digests run via Cranewell's `digestd` service. Three windows: 06:00, 12:00, 18:00 local. Scheduling changes require a config PR plus sign-off at the weekly eng sync — no ad-hoc edits. Missed windows auto-retry once after 15 minutes, then drop to the dead-letter queue. Check the queue before declaring an incident. Dashboards linked in the repo README. Agenda items for sync go to the list below.

billing contact of kagag-bagep = ulaax@orvexcloud.example